190715-N-WK982-6619 CORAL SEA (July 15, 2019) The crew of the Ticonderoga-class guided-missile cruiser USS Chancellorsville (CG 62) transports cargo across the flight deck during a vertical replenishment-at-sea with the dry cargo and ammunition ship USNS Matthew Perry (T-AKE 9). Chancellorsville, part of Carrier Strike Group 5, is currently participating in Talisman Sabre 2019 off the coast of Northern Australia. A bilateral, biennial event Talisman Sabre is designed to improve U.S. and Australian combat training, readiness and interoperability through realistic, relevant training necessary to maintain regional security, peace and stability.
